**Q: What happens when Mailcull marks a bounce as permanent?**

Mailcull, our email bounce processor, classifies hard bounces after three consecutive failures and suppresses the address automatically. Soft bounces are retried for 72 hours. If the suppression list itself becomes corrupted, restore it from the encrypted nightly snapshot in the Thornfield backup bucket. Restoring requires the team recovery passphrase, which is kept directly below this entry for emergencies.

unlock words, kahof-bahap: praax-ulaix

TICKET — Missed pick-up: film reels for the Wrenmoor Archive

Quick heads-up: the courier never showed yesterday for the twelve film reels bound for the Wrenmoor Archive's cold-storage vault. The canisters are still sitting in the back office, which isn't ideal for old acetate stock. I've rebooked with Stillgate Transit for tomorrow before lunch. Please keep the room cool until then and have the inventory list taped to the top canister. The courier's confidential hand-over instruction is noted below.

courier memo of fahag-badug: the norys istion courier leaves the zoriel ledger at gate 4000 under passcode 457370

Runbook: GarageGlance occupancy feed

If the Harborview Deck occupancy feed goes stale (no updates for 5+ minutes), first check the sensor gateway health page. Green but stale usually means the aggregator queue is backed up; restart the aggregator via the ops console and counts should recover within two minutes. If spots show negative numbers, force a full recount from the camera snapshots. When escalating to engineering, include the trace token shown below.

session token of yawif-kahof = htk9_dd6996ed6

FAQ: Driver-assignment heuristic — Pellam Dispatch

For the security reviewer: Q: How does RouteWeaver pick a driver? A: It scores candidates on proximity, shift remaining, and vehicle fit, then assigns the top score unless a fairness cap triggers rotation. Scores are recomputed every 20 seconds; no personal data leaves the regional cluster. Manual overrides are logged and require supervisor approval. The heuristic's signed configuration bundle can only be modified after unsealing the config store, which requires the recovery passphrase below.

unlock words, kagef-taduf: fenir-quenix-norwyn-sorvan-gormir-gorir-fraok